const cmn = require("../$common.js");
const fs = require("fs");
const https = require("https");
const child_process = require("child_process");

const generateTemplate = require("./template.js");

let moddir = null;
let repodir = null;
const repoRemote = "https://git.tomsmeding.com/blog";

// Cache for rendered posts; null if currently being rendered
let templateCache = new Map();
// Clients that requested a post that is currently being rendered; values are
// callbacks that take (http status code, rendered html [= null if status != 200])
let renderWatchers = new Map();

function triggerRenderWatchers(path, statusCode, rendered) {
	const list = renderWatchers.get(path);
	if (list !== undefined) {
		try {
			for (const callback of list) callback(statusCode, rendered);
		} catch(e) {
			console.error("While triggering render watchers:", e);
		}
		renderWatchers.delete(path);
	}
}

function fetch(url) {
	return new Promise((resolve, reject) => {
		https.get(url, res => {
			if (res.statusCode != 200) {
				reject(`HTTP status code ${res.statusCode}`);
				return;
			}

			let buffers = [];
			res.on("data", d => buffers.push(d));
			res.on("end", () => {
				resolve(Buffer.concat(buffers));
			});
		}).on("error", err => {
			reject(err);
		});
	});
}

function runCommand(cmd, args) {
	console.log(`blog: ${cmd} ${JSON.stringify(args)}`);
	child_process.execFileSync(
		cmd, args,
		{ stdio: "inherit", timeout: 20000 }
	);
}

function runCommandOutput(cmd, args) {
	return child_process.execFileSync(
		cmd, args,
		{ timeout: 20000 }
	);
}

function ensureRepo() {
	try {
		const stats = fs.statSync(repodir);
		if (stats.isDirectory()) return;
	} catch (e) {}

	runCommand("git", ["clone", "https://git.tomsmeding.com/blog", repodir]);
}

function currentCommit() {
	return runCommandOutput("git", ["-C", repodir, "rev-parse", "HEAD"]).toString().trim();
}

async function upstreamCommit() {
	const body = await fetch(repoRemote + "/info/refs");
	return body.toString().split("\t")[0];
}

function updateRepo() {
	try {
		runCommand("git", ["-C", repodir, "fetch", "--all"]);
		runCommand("git", ["-C", repodir, "reset", "origin/master", "--hard"]);
		// Reset cache _after_ the commands succeeded; if anything failed, we
		// might at least still have stale cache data
		templateCache = new Map();
	} catch (e) {
		console.error("Cannot update blog git repo!");
		console.error(e);
	}
}

async function periodicUpdateCheck() {
	let shouldUpdate = false;
	try {
		const local = currentCommit();
		const remote = await upstreamCommit();
		if (local != remote) shouldUpdate = true;
	} catch (e) {
		// Also update if our pre-check fails for some reason
		shouldUpdate = true;
	}
	if (shouldUpdate) updateRepo();
}

setInterval(function () {
	periodicUpdateCheck().catch(err => console.error(err));
}, 3600 * 1000);

module.exports = (app, io, _moddir) => {
	moddir = _moddir;
	repodir = moddir + "/repo";

	ensureRepo();
	updateRepo();

	app.get("/blog", (req, res, next) => {
		req.url = "/blog/";
		next();
	});

	app.get("/blog/*", (req, res) => {
		if (req.path.indexOf("/.") != -1) {
			res.sendStatus(404);
			return;
		}

		const path = req.path
				.slice(6)
				.replace(/\/[\/]*/g, "/")
				.replace(/\.html$/, "");

		const fromCache = templateCache.get(path);

		if (fromCache != null) {  // neither null nor undefined
			res.send(fromCache);
		} else if (fromCache !== undefined) {
			// Is currently being renderered for another client
			if (!renderWatchers.has(path)) renderWatchers.set(path, []);
			renderWatchers.get(path).push((statusCode, rendered) => {
				if (statusCode == 200) res.send(rendered);
				else res.sendStatus(statusCode);
			});
		} else {
			// Indicate that this path is currently being rendered
			templateCache.set(path, null);

			generateTemplate(repodir, path ? path + ".html" : undefined)
				.then(rendered => {
					templateCache.set(path, rendered);
					triggerRenderWatchers(path, 200, rendered);
					res.send(rendered);
				})
				.catch(err => {
					if (err.code && err.code == "ENOENT") {
						triggerRenderWatchers(path, 400, null);
						res.sendStatus(404);
					} else {
						triggerRenderWatchers(path, 500, null);
						console.error(err);
						res.sendStatus(500);
					}
				});
		}
	});
};
